Quick Answer
BMW hidden features accessible via BimmerCode and OBD coding include: one-tap indicators (3 or 5 blinks), fold mirrors on lock, needle sweep animation on startup, sport display gauges (oil temp, boost, power), video-in-motion, seatbelt chime disable, ambient lighting zone unlocks, M startup screen logo, comfort closing (windows roll up on lock), and Alpina instrument cluster style. F-series models allow most of these via BimmerCode with an ENET cable. G-series post-I-level 23-03 requires professional NCD 2.0 coding.

What You Need for Safe BMW Coding
If you want to use BimmerCode successfully, keep the process simple and stable:
1. Use a quality OBD adapter
Cheap adapters can cause connection drops or incomplete coding sessions. A stable adapter is especially important when writing changes to control modules.
2. Keep battery voltage steady
Low voltage is one of the most common causes of coding issues. If you plan to code multiple functions, it is smart to use a battery charger or maintainer.
3. Backup original settings
BimmerCode makes it easy to save your factory configuration. Always do this before changing anything, so you can revert if needed.
4. Code one feature at a time
Making too many changes in one session can make troubleshooting harder. Test each change before moving to the next.

BMW Coding Tips for CarPlay and Infotainment Issues
Not every infotainment problem is solved by coding, but understanding the difference between a coding issue, a phone issue, and a software bug can save time.
Wireless CarPlay suddenly says “connection failed”
After major smartphone updates, some users experience wireless CarPlay connection failures even when nothing changed in the car. One practical diagnostic step is to check whether the phone is stuck on a 169.254.x.x IP address. That typically points to a stale DHCP or network negotiation issue rather than a coding problem in the BMW itself.
Try this sequence:
1. Delete the CarPlay device pairing from iDrive.
2. Forget the BMW Wi-Fi and Bluetooth connection on the phone.
3. Restart the phone and the vehicle.
4. Re-pair Bluetooth first, then allow CarPlay to rebuild the Wi-Fi connection.
If the phone grabs a self-assigned IP again, the issue is more likely network-related than caused by BimmerCode changes.
CarPlay display looks more zoomed after an app update
Sometimes a wireless projection app or interface update changes aspect ratio, scaling, or display rendering. If the screen suddenly appears more zoomed, first check display settings in iDrive and on the phone before changing any coding values. Software updates can alter UI scaling without any change in the vehicle’s coding profile.
A good rule: if the issue appeared immediately after a phone or interface update, troubleshoot software compatibility first. If it appeared after coding, restore your backup and retest.
Navigation points the wrong direction
When a CarPlay navigation app shows the vehicle going east while the map indicates west, do not assume the phone is always at fault. Direction errors can come from the phone’s compass, the vehicle’s heading data, or the communication between them. Test with multiple apps, compare native BMW navigation versus CarPlay, and recalibrate the phone compass. If the native BMW map is correct but CarPlay is wrong, start with the phone. If both are wrong, investigate vehicle sensor data before changing coding settings.
Best Practices Before You Activate New Features
BMW coding is rewarding, but thoughtful preparation matters. Here are a few smart habits:
Research feature compatibility: not every function works on every chassis or iDrive version.
Avoid random expert-mode changes: if you do not understand a value, leave it alone.
Test after every session: check lighting, cameras, audio, locks, and infotainment before ending your work.
Know when coding is not enough: some upgrades require proper hardware support, not just software changes.
